The document outlines the concepts of population and sampling design, detailing the types of sampling methods used in research. It distinguishes between probability sampling, which includes simple random, stratified, systematic, and cluster sampling, and non-probability sampling, which includes convenience, quota, purposive, and snowball sampling. Each sampling method is briefly described, highlighting their unique characteristics and applications.
